An Authentic New Orleans Experience Is Just One Trip Away

It is hard to consider visiting the attractions in New Orleans subsequent to the catostrophic effects of Hurricane Katrina. Nevertheless following almost 5 years the guests have enlarged and who possibly will criticize them, French Quarter is one of the most time-honored, mysteriously stunning neighborhoods to visit for multiple reasons. The foodstuff, the the ambience, and the music are 3 main sights that draw interest to the streets of French Quarter, previously known as Vieux Carre is among the list of the most established places in New Orleans. Established by a Frenchman, the area as a whole is known as a National Historical Landmark that luckily had negligible damage brought on by the natural disaster 5 years ago.

French Quarter district is made of splendid cuisines most famous clearly being the French, Creole, and Cajun. Most famous are the legendary restaurants that promote dining in the city to the pinnacle of everyone's list- Galatoire's Arnaud's Commander's Palace within the Garden District, Broussard's and Antoine's are the originals. Nonetheless, a few recently new spots have been placed on summit of the charts - Emeril's, Emeirl's Delmoncio, Emeril's NOLA and K-Paul's. Plus locate reasonable dining with good taste at Acme Oyster House, Casamento's and also the Gumbo Shop. Plus for dessert, it can be a requirement to go on a leisurely walk up to Cafe du Monde for beignets and smooth New Orleans style coffee with chicory and observe the French Quarter art.

Lately, the amazing music you will listen to in the region of French Quarter distinguishes itself More Than the foodstuff. Vintage New Orleans jazz continues to be king at the Preservation Hall Jazz Band building on St. Peter Street that goes back to the era of the War of 1812. Louis Armstrong and Jelly Roll Morton used to be in cooperation members of this incredible musical band that has certainly been attracting music lovers since the year of 1961. Nowadays, the musicians are perhaps younger but the glorious New Orleans jazz they play here is as wholesome as ever. No beverages and no refrigerated air keep some from coming, but they are missing the genuine thing, music-wise!

As a music style, jazz is well established as the authorized sound of the municipality, however, additional amazing music genre artists such as Lenny Kravitz calls the city his hometown. As a result, modern, younger music exist in harmony with time-honored New Orleans sounds like from Louis Armstrong. It's also the birth-place for among the most famous music festivals called The Annual Voodoo Experience Ritual occurs each October. The band list for this upcoming festival include Muse, Ozzy Ozbourne, Paul Van Dyke, MGMT, Hot Chip and hottest rapper currently Drake, numerous more!

The French Quarter was spared by Hurricane Katrina as it is the highest district of the metropolis. And its unique architecture like narrow streets, wrought iron balconies over the streets, blind alleys and splendidly old buildings (in forms of narrow, tall, short or stout) that invites exploration as well as estimations of who, when, and what became of people who previously lived here. Lots of these structures were formerly owned by rich plantation proprietors Who Loved their seasons in the city. During the past times, the French Quarter was shared by absinthe houses, brothels, gambling parlors, convents, tea shops, and popular clothing manufacturers. Plus this really is as close as one could get to French life style as New Orleans imitated the style. In recent times you will discover that absinthe dens are utilized by bars and dressmakers are overtaken by souvenir, mask and bead stores. In spite of this, you'll be able to still observe the beautiful church cathedral that was the religious center of the old city still found on Jackson Square. As you calmly sit and bite at your beignets at Cafe du Monde, you'll have a crystal clear view of the church cathedral to witness its amazing architecture.

Possibly after that, a walk to the church cathedral would function to burn off your sins and indulgences and make Your Way right down to Royal Street to get a shopping bender and admire the European antiques that formerly would grace these homes. One block away from there is the Bourbon Street famed for its exciting line up of bars, adult entertainments and Much More!

This is now the city to get some great use out of your feet, every corner features a surprise of its own from not yet known shops, restaurants, protected gardens to even the specter of another time - a genuine New Orleans ghost.
